Barb Roche
About Barb Roche
Barb Roche is the Vice President and Senior Manager of Creative Services at Jefferies LLC, with a background in customer sales and computer graphics from AGI and a strong educational foundation in commercial and advertising art, graphic design, and visual communications.
Vice President at Jefferies LLC
Barb Roche currently holds the position of Vice President - Senior Manager, Creative Services at Jefferies LLC. Based in Los Angeles, CA, Roche has been with the company from 1997. In her role, she oversees the comprehensive collection of creative media and software solutions essential for publishing sales and marketing collateral. She provides mentoring and leadership to the creative services team, ensuring high-performance standards and professional development.
Previous Experience at AGI
Before joining Jefferies LLC, Barb Roche worked at AGI as a Customer Sales/Computer Graphics Specialist from 1994 to 1996, based in Los Angeles, California. During her tenure at AGI, she specialized in customer sales and computer graphic services, honing her skills in graphic design and customer interaction.
Education and Qualifications
Barb Roche has a rich educational background in art and design. She obtained her bachelor's degree in Commercial and Advertising Art from the University of Minnesota Duluth in 1970. Additionally, she has studied at UCLA and the University of Birmingham, where she pursued graphic design studies, visual communications, and liberal arts, further enhancing her expertise in creative arts and visual communication.
